READBYTE Read digital port input
The response to the READBYTE command is an integer between 0 and 255
representing the binary value of all eight lines of the instrument rear panel digital
port. Hence, for example, if PORTDIR = 255 and the response to READBYTE is
255, then all lines are high, and if the response to READBYTE is 0, then all lines are
low. Note that because the command does not differentiate between whether a line is
configured as an input or output, it can be used as a single command to determine the
present status of all eight lines, both inputs and outputs, of the port.
REFMODE [n] Reference mode selector
The value of n sets the reference mode of the instrument according to the following
table:
n Mode
0 Single Reference / Virtual Reference mode
1 Dual Harmonic mode
2 Dual Reference mode
NOTE: When in either of the dual reference modes the command set changes to
accommodate the additional controls. These changes are detailed in section 6.7.14
REFMON [n] Reference monitor control
The value of n sets the function of the rear panel TRIG OUT connector according to
the following table:
n Mode
0 Trig Out signal is generated by curve buffer triggering
1 Trig Out signal is a TTL signal at the reference frequency (i.e. it is a Reference
Monitor output)
REFN [n] Reference harmonic mode control
The value of n sets the reference channel to one of the NF modes, or restores it to the
default 1F mode. The value of n is in the range 1 to 127.
REFP[.] [n] Reference phase control
In fixed point mode n sets the phase in millidegrees in the range ±360000.
In floating point mode n sets the phase in degrees.
